WebGraph theory is a branch of mathematics concerned about how networks can be encoded, and their properties measured. 1. Basic Graph Definition. A graph is a symbolic representation of a network and its connectivity. It implies an abstraction of reality so that it can be simplified as a set of linked nodes. WebIn graph theory, a matching in a graph is a set of edges that do not have a set of common vertices. In other words, a matching is a graph where each node has either zero or one edge incident to it. Graph matching is not to be confused with graph isomorphism. Web5: Graph Theory. Graph Theory is a relatively new area of mathematics, first studied by the super famous mathematician Leonhard Euler in 1735. Since then it has blossomed in to a powerful tool used in nearly every branch of science and is currently an active area of mathematics research. Pictures like the dot and line drawing are called graphs. WebIn graph theory, a tree is an undirected graph in which any two vertices are connected by exactly one path, or equivalently a connected acyclic undirected graph. A forest is an undirected graph in which any two vertices are connected by at most one path, or equivalently an acyclic undirected graph, or equivalently a disjoint union of trees..
